Duties and Responsibilities
• Set up and operate Wire EDM machines (such as Mitsubishi and Current) for production and prototype runs
• Set up and operate HP EDM machines, including electrode selection, dielectric fluid management, and gap control
• Read, interpret, and program using NC/CNC EDM code specific to EDM control systems — not general G-code programming
• Select appropriate wire types, diameters, and tension settings based on material and tolerance requirements
• Interpret engineering drawings, GD&T callouts, and 3D models to verify part conformance
• Perform in-process inspection using precision metrology instruments including micrometers, CMM, optical comparators, and surface finish gauges
• Perform secondary operations including deburring, cleaning, and surface preparation specific to EDM-produced parts
• Maintain machine electrode wear logs, dielectric fluid levels, and filter change schedules
• Troubleshoot EDM-specific issues including wire breakage, surface finish defects, and electrode wear deviation
• Ensure all finished parts meet customer specifications and internal quality standards
Minimum Requirements
• Completion of a formal EDM operator/machinist training program or apprenticeship — general CNC machinist training without EDM-specific curriculum does not satisfy this requirement
• Minimum 3 years of hands-on experience operating both Wire EDM and HP EDM machines in a production or precision manufacturing environment
• Demonstrated ability to write and edit NC programs on EDM control systems (Wire and HP)
• Proficiency reading engineering drawings with GD&T per ASME Y14.5 standards
• Experience holding tolerances of ±0.0002" or tighter on EDM-machined parts
• Experience with precision inspection equipment: micrometers, height gauges, CMM, and optical comparators
• Ability to perform all secondary operations associated with EDM-produced parts (deburring, cleaning, rust prevention)
• Physical ability to stand for extended periods, lift up to 50 lbs, and work in a manufacturing environment
